Output 344877b39f0f656aac51170ac0133d9e5b4906132561f55e02ed81a755de8d6b:1

value
4104609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4da36f4c0619d9bacdec84a06648e79224e5e95f OP_EQUAL
address
38mXjxfGEni3syCwWL1umD2voTm8NA8ZuB
transaction
344877b39f0f656aac51170ac0133d9e5b4906132561f55e02ed81a755de8d6b
spent
true